Rookie pick. Also, Ben King was quite and he probably wont be drafted.TT starts last quarter with putrid effort at 5 minute mark going to ground in forward pocket unnecessarily and giving away a free.
Moved into the midfield and got a few kick in middle part of quarter filling the hole across half back.
Had a chance to win the game in last few minutes. Was kicking from 55 meters out but late in the game was tired and his run in was going right for extra distance and that’s where ball went. OOF.
Went to ground unnecessarily twice again in last quarter. This is his biggest flaw in his game. Don’t know if it’s because he has a bad technique or because he has played against men in Tasmania since about 16 years of age. Trying to tackle men where he probably needed to put his whole body weight into the tackle to try and bring them down and has carried this bad habit into his game.
Hopefully will be easy enough to train that out of him at AFL level.
Overall game was below average.
